The TomoScope® FQ family of instruments allows the calculation and evaluation of the measurement point cloud to be accelerated by up to 50 times. For workpieces such as valve blocks, housings and castings, the geometrical characteristics can be determined almost every half minute, a nominal-actual comparison with the measuring point cloud of a master part can be carried out and the workpieces can be tested for defects such as burrs. The WinWerth® Scout measurement software offers a clear status display for run-out and completed measuring processes and access to all measurement results at the click of a mouse.
• All TomoScope® measuring machines are available as "FQ" version
• Maintenance-free closed high-performance X-ray tube for fast measurement of dense materials and large workpieces
• Integrated shutter to avoid time-consuming switching on and off of the tube with extended lifetime
• High-end detector for high-performance measurement with fast image acquisition in OnTheFly mode
• Workpiece feeding with robot through front door or upper loading opening
• Remote programming at offline workstations
• Start of the measuring process, for example via QR code or RFID chip, so that workpieces and batches can be clearly identified
• Task sharing between computed tomography and multi-sensor coordinate measuring machines
